Output 51aec7d26f1276153ee08b23cb3ace1473764a10901e7bc08a8b3241a4daf19a:0

value
6663952
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 627b3cb93193cb11178650a6959786c976be4fe9 OP_EQUALVERIFY OP_CHECKSIG
address
19yirUGnLN28YrU2bkj8oMXpuF6xPGhiMU
transaction
51aec7d26f1276153ee08b23cb3ace1473764a10901e7bc08a8b3241a4daf19a
spent
true